Immigrants from Egypt vs Syrian Bachelor's Degree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 245,484,715 people shows a substantial neg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Egypt and percentage of population with at least bachelor's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.555 and weighted average of 42.6%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 266,300,511 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Syrians and percentage of population with at least bachelor's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.065 and weighted average of 41.1%, a difference of 3.5%.
